summaryrefslogtreecommitdiff
path: root/includes/session.php
diff options
context:
space:
mode:
authorRaindropsSys <raindrops@equestria.dev>2023-10-30 23:08:45 +0100
committerRaindropsSys <raindrops@equestria.dev>2023-10-30 23:08:45 +0100
commit41c51b8bdb9c8e9fa4a7d56f260d594739d4107e (patch)
tree4bb3e824d636c7cf8cb39fd0e1aa25c49c339164 /includes/session.php
parent4d4308c46d4f7801c657cc79d2243e1a81831334 (diff)
downloadmist-41c51b8bdb9c8e9fa4a7d56f260d594739d4107e.tar.gz
mist-41c51b8bdb9c8e9fa4a7d56f260d594739d4107e.tar.bz2
mist-41c51b8bdb9c8e9fa4a7d56f260d594739d4107e.zip
Updated 35 files and added 28 files (automated)
Diffstat (limited to 'includes/session.php')
-rw-r--r--includes/session.php16
1 files changed, 9 insertions, 7 deletions
diff --git a/includes/session.php b/includes/session.php
index 36c5216..e9f9f30 100644
--- a/includes/session.php
+++ b/includes/session.php
@@ -72,12 +72,14 @@ function displayList($list, $hasAlbum = false) { global $albums; global $favorit
<img class="icon" alt="" src="/assets/icons/menu.svg" style="pointer-events: none; width: 32px; height: 32px;" id="btn-menu-<?= $id ?>-icon">
</span>
<ul class="dropdown-menu">
- <li><a onclick="playNext('<?= $id ?>');" class="dropdown-item" href="#"><img alt="" src="/assets/icons/playnext.svg" style="pointer-events: none; width: 24px; height: 24px; margin-right: 5px;">Play next</a></li>
- <li><a onclick="enqueue('<?= $id ?>');" class="dropdown-item" href="#"><img alt="" src="/assets/icons/add.svg" style="pointer-events: none; width: 24px; height: 24px; margin-right: 5px;">Add to queue</a></li>
- <li><hr class="dropdown-divider"></hr></li>
- <li><a id="btn-favorite-<?= $id ?>" onclick="<?= in_array($id, $favorites) ? "un" : "" ?>favoriteSong('<?= $id ?>');" class="dropdown-item" href="#"><img id="btn-favorite-<?= $id ?>-icon" alt="" src="/assets/icons/favorite-<?= in_array($id, $favorites) ? "on" : "off" ?>.svg" style="pointer-events: none; width: 24px; height: 24px; margin-right: 5px;"><span id="btn-favorite-<?= $id ?>-text"><?= in_array($id, $favorites) ? "Remove from favorites" : "Add to favorites" ?></span></a></li>
- <li><a onclick="downloadSong('<?= $id ?>');" class="dropdown-item" href="#"><img alt="" src="/assets/icons/download.svg" style="pointer-events: none; width: 24px; height: 24px; margin-right: 5px;">Download</a></li>
- <li><a onclick="getInfo('<?= $id ?>');" class="dropdown-item" href="#"><img alt="" src="/assets/icons/info.svg" style="pointer-events: none; width: 24px; height: 24px; margin-right: 5px;">Get info</a></li>
+ <li><a onclick="playNext('<?= $id ?>');" class="dropdown-item" style="cursor: pointer;"><img alt="" src="/assets/icons/playnext.svg" style="pointer-events: none; width: 24px; height: 24px; margin-right: 5px;">Play next</a></li>
+ <li><a onclick="enqueue('<?= $id ?>');" class="dropdown-item" style="cursor: pointer;"><img alt="" src="/assets/icons/add.svg" style="pointer-events: none; width: 24px; height: 24px; margin-right: 5px;">Add to queue</a></li>
+ <li><hr class="dropdown-divider"></li>
+ <li><a id="btn-favorite-<?= $id ?>" onclick="<?= in_array($id, $favorites) ? "un" : "" ?>favoriteSong('<?= $id ?>');" class="dropdown-item" style="cursor: pointer;"><img id="btn-favorite-<?= $id ?>-icon" alt="" src="/assets/icons/favorite-<?= in_array($id, $favorites) ? "on" : "off" ?>.svg" style="pointer-events: none; width: 24px; height: 24px; margin-right: 5px;"><span id="btn-favorite-<?= $id ?>-text"><?= in_array($id, $favorites) ? "Remove from favorites" : "Add to favorites" ?></span></a></li>
+ <li><a onclick="downloadSong('<?= $id ?>');" class="dropdown-item" style="cursor: pointer;"><img alt="" src="/assets/icons/download.svg" style="pointer-events: none; width: 24px; height: 24px; margin-right: 5px;">Download</a></li>
+ <li><a onclick="getInfo('<?= $id ?>');" class="dropdown-item" style="cursor: pointer;"><img alt="" src="/assets/icons/info.svg" style="pointer-events: none; width: 24px; height: 24px; margin-right: 5px;">Get info</a></li>
+ <li><hr class="dropdown-divider"></li>
+ <li><a onclick="navigator.clipboard.writeText('<?= $id ?>');" class="dropdown-item" style="cursor: pointer;"><img alt="" src="/assets/icons/copy.svg" style="pointer-events: none; width: 24px; height: 24px; margin-right: 5px;">Copy ID</a></li>
</ul>
</span>
</div>
@@ -100,7 +102,7 @@ function displayList($list, $hasAlbum = false) { global $albums; global $favorit
if (window.parent.playlist.length === 0) {
window.parent.playSong(id);
} else {
- window.parent.playlist.splice(window.parent.currentPlaylistPosition, 0, id);
+ window.parent.playlist.splice(window.parent.currentPlaylistPosition + 1, 0, id);
}
}